OS X Tip: Quick open Applications/Utlities;

I recently discovered two neat little keystrokes to quickly navigate to common locations in OS X.

Both of which make navigating Finder easier than it already is.

If you want to quickly open Applications, in Finder run;

cmd+shift+a

If you want to quickly open Utilities, in Finder press:

cmd+shift+u
